GENERAL SUMMARY: Security Officers (SO) will be located in the front lobbies of buildings A, B, C and D and will be responsible for facilitating the safe flow of patients and visitors in and out of the facility. SOs protect life and property and ensures the safety and security of Sibley Memorial Hospital staff, patients, and visitors through adherence to department policies and procedures. SOs effectively execute duties and responsibilities, maintaining and utilizing successful interpersonal and customer service skills. The SO will ensure that customers are greeted upon entry into the facility and are treated in a professional and courteous manner at all times.

MINIMUM E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E:

  • High school diploma or equivalent.
  • Possession of D.C. Security Officer License.
  • Minimum of one year of experience in the field of law enforcement and/or security management.
  • Must possess a valid driver’s license.
  • Must be certified in CPR or obtain certification within 30 days of employment and maintain active CPR certification throughout employment at Sibley Hospital.
